We made reservations to Chart House on my birthday since we were going to be downtown for the St. Patrick's day festivities and I had a pretty decent group with me. Having dinner in front of the fish tank was awesome but made me wonder if the fish I was eating was the lucky one to get plucked outta the tank.
I was surprised that they had made a personalized menu for my table. Apparently they ask if anyone is celebrating a special occasion when you call to make reservations. I thought this was pretty cool. Plus they let me keep the personalized menus. A very nice gesture.
Ok on to the food, the sea bass with saffron risotto was tasty. I think I enjoyed that better than my dish. I had the stuffed flounder, which was good but the flounder had no flavor and a little dry until you mixed it with the crab. The sea bass though, mmm. I also heard that the jumbo stuffed shrimp, surf & turf, and fish & chips were very enjoyable.
Overall the experience was awesome especially since it was in downtown. Our waiter Eddie was funny, very helpful and willing to split our checks. Towards the end of our dining experience, they brought out their Hot Chocolate Lava Cake and Eddie initiated the Happy Birthday song. Kudos to this guy! I heart Downtown Vegas and find it appealing when you find these hidden gems in that area.
